Cinnamon is an ingredient you can eat sweeten your food with without any extra calories or sugar. The great thing about cinnamon is its ability to draw the natural sweetness out of particular food items while adding no unnecessary sugar and causing no increases in blood glucose. Some even believe that cinnamon will lower blood glucose levels, but the jury is still out on that one.

Alter your favorite foods that you love eating as opposed to eliminating them. One of the hardest things diabetics deal with is the diet can be very restrictive. Many even believe that they have to completely eliminate all their favorite dishes. Others tend to ignore the diet and still consume their favorite foods. The better solution is to look closely at the foods to make them acceptable. Many dishes can turn into diabetes-friendly meals by using healthier ingredients as alternatives where appropriate.

Skipping meals will most likely cause your blood sugar levels to rise as your liver begins to release glucose in order to give your body energy. To keep your blood sugar levels stable, eat regular meals and sensible carbohydrate-rich snacks.

TIP! Staying physically active is a great way to prevent, or manage your diabetes. Exercise increases your insulin sensitivity so that insulin more efficiently converts blood sugar to energy.
